How do I block localhost connections with the Windows 7/2008R2 firewall?

Problem

With the Windows 7/2008R2 firewall it doesn't seem possible to explicitly block connections that use 127.0.0.1 on a per process basis. Have I missed something?

Given that is the loopback device, I would assume that special rules apply. It wouldn't surprise me if any traffic on the loopback device simply bypasses (at least) the Windows firewall.
